Pine Tree Trimming in Doylestown, PA

Pine tree trimming services involve carefully removing overgrown or damaged branches to maintain the health, appearance, and safety of pine trees on residential properties. These services typically cover pruning to shape the tree, removing dead or diseased limbs, and reducing the size of the tree to prevent interference with structures or power lines. Homeowners interested in pine tree trimming should consider factors such as the tree’s size, location, and overall condition, as well as any specific aesthetic or safety concerns they may have.

Before requesting pine tree trimming, property owners often want to understand the scope of the work, including which parts of the tree will be affected and how the trimming will impact its growth and health. It’s also helpful to clarify any preferences regarding the tree’s shape or size, and to discuss potential risks associated with trimming larger or hard-to-reach branches. Proper trimming can promote healthier growth and enhance the landscape, making it a valuable step in maintaining a safe and attractive property.

Project Types

Common Pine Tree Trimming Jobs

Tree trimming - shaping and reducing tree size to improve health and appearance.

Pruning - removing dead or overgrown branches to promote growth and safety.

Crown thinning - selectively trimming branches to increase light and airflow through the canopy.

Height reduction - carefully lowering tree height to prevent interference with structures or power lines.

Storm damage cleanup - removing broken or hazardous limbs after severe weather events.

Selective pruning - targeting specific branches to enhance tree structure and longevity.

FAQ

Pine Tree Trimming Questions

What are the benefits of trimming pine trees? Regular trimming promotes healthy growth, improves appearance, and reduces the risk of falling branches.

When is the best time to trim pine trees? The ideal time is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How does trimming affect pine tree health? Proper trimming removes dead or diseased branches, helping to prevent pests and disease spread.

What tools are used for pine tree trimming? Professional trimming typically involves pruning shears, saws, and pole pruners for precise cuts.
